Channel Waste Water Appropriately, Abia Town Planners To Car Wash Operators by Nwokomaizuchi: 6:29am On Jun 13, 2022
Worried by the heavy waterlog witnessed around places used for car wash businesses in Umuahia and Aba metropolis, the Nigerian Institute of Town Planners, Abia State Chapter, is appealing to those doing car wash business, to do more to channel the waste water used for their business appropriately.

The Institute said this has become imperative going by the heavy waterlog experienced in areas where the roads are tarred and untarred, noting that some car wash operators in these areas do little or nothing to ensure that the already existing drainages are opened up so that waste water can pass through.

Speaking at the weekend after witnessing a sordid site housing car wash operators in Umuahia the capital, the Chairman of the Institute, Town Planner Stephen Chukwudi Nwazue, said the Institute is not witch-hunting anyone, or groups, adding that its responsibility is to ensure a habitable town for all.

Tpl Nwazue who decried the activities of car wash operators in areas where the roads are not tarred, charged them to, at least collaborate with their neighbors during sanitation days and find solution to the heavy waterlog witnessed in their areas of operation.

He said those that wash cars on the tarred roads weaken the strength of the roads and also reduce the size of the road because the vehicles park along the road, urging them to channel the waste water appropriately and also avoid causing traffic within such areas.

He said this has become pertinent as "we are entering the peak of rainy season", stressing that mosquitoes breed in this areas that are waterlogged hence the need to find a permanent solution to the problem for the benefit of inhabitants of those areas.

Tpl Nwazue urged the government through the Ministry of Environment, to assist those doing car wash business with manpower, especially during sanitation days, noting that this will assist in maintaining a decent and aesthetically sound and safe city.
